High-paying nursing jobs in Warwick
Nursing is caring for patients and managing healthcare. Nurses provide essential support by monitoring patient conditions and administering treatments. They need empathy, attention to detail, and strong communication skills to deliver quality care.
The 1,459 nursing jobs listed below pay well, with salaries between $51,059 and $213,198 per year. Registered Nurse, Nursing Assistant and Licensed Practical Nurse are among the most popular high-paying roles in Warwick, RI.
